فهرست مطالب
همان طور که در مقاله “پایتون چیست” با کاربردهای متفاوت و گسترده این زبان برنامه نویسی آشنا شدید، یکی از کاربردهای شناخته شده این زبان برنامه نویسی در زمینه هک و امنیت است و هک با پایتون نیز به موارد گسترده کاربرد این زبان برنامه نویسی اضافه شده است. پایتون به عنوان یک زبان منبع باز، به برنامه نویسان اجازه می دهد تا مجموعه های متعددی از کدهای از پیش ترکیب شده را ایجاد کنند و کتابخانه هایی تشکیل دهند که اسکریپت (Script) پایتون را جامع تر و ایمن تر می کند و امنیت شبکه و هک با پایتون را مطرح می کنند. بعد آشنایی با پایتون در مقاله درج شده، بهتر است با هک و انواع هک آشنا شوید.
هک چیست؟
اصطلاح هک (Hack) برای مدت طولانی وجود داشته است، اولین نمونه ثبت شده هک مربوط به اوایل دهه 60 میلادی در موسسه فناوری ماساچوست برمی گردد که دو اصطلاح هک و هکر که از آن زمان ابداع شده اند، و در واقع به یک رشته گسترده تبدیل شد. برای جامعه محاسباتی امروزه هک اخلاقی فرآیند شناسایی آسیبپذیریهای سیستم از طریق دسترسی غیرمجاز به سیستم خاص برای انجام فعالیتهایی است که میتواند از حذف فایلها تا سرقت برخی اطلاعات حساس را شامل شود.
به عنوان یک مهندس علوم کامپیوتر که جهان را رمزگذاری می کند، باید بدانید که فعالیت های هک با پایتون چگونه انجام می شود و ما چگونه باید در مقابل مجرمان سایبری بایستیم و از دنیای خود محافظت کنیم.
هک شامل چه فعالیت هایی میشود؟
هک شامل سطوح مختلفی است و تمامی موارد هک پیچیدگی هک با پایتون را ندارند. بصورت کلی دسترسی به سیستمی که قرار نیست به آن دسترسی داشته باشید به عنوان هک شناخته می شود. به عنوان مثال، ورود به یک حساب ایمیل بدون مجوز به عنوان هک آن حساب در نظر گرفته می شود. دسترسی به یک کامپیوتر از راه دور بدون مجوز، هک کردن آن کامپیوتر است. بنابراین می بینید که روش های زیادی برای هک کردن یک سیستم وجود دارد و کلمه هک می تواند به بخش های متفاوتی اشاره کند اما مفهوم اصلی یکسان است. به دست آوردن دسترسی یا توانایی انجام کارهایی که قرار نیست قادر به انجام آنها باشید نیز، هک محسوب می شود. حال در این مقاله به هک با پایتون که یکی از نرم افزار های مورد استفاده در این زمینه بسیار مطرح شده است میپردازیم.
هک با پایتون
آیا هک با پایتون انجام میشود؟ پایتون به عنوان یکی از سریعترین زبانهای برنامهنویسی در حال رشد شناخته میشود و همه کاره است و به طور گسترده توسط کارشناسان امنیتی و هکرها برای هک اخلاقی (هک کلاه سفید) استفاده میشود. در این مطلب، 7 کتابخانه پایتون موثر برای هک با پایتون به صورت اخلاقی را خواهید خواند.
جدای از کاربرد پایتون در توسعه وب، برنامه نویسی اندروید با پایتون، علم داده و یادگیری ماشینی، توسط هکرها و بخشهای امنیت سایبری برای شناسایی شکست در شبکههای کامپیوتری و به خطر انداختن پروتکلهای امنیتی استفاده میشود. هک با پایتون همچنین توسط هکرهای اخلاقی برای توسعه ابزارها و تکنیک های موثر هک استفاده می شود که می تواند بدافزارها و آسیب پذیری هایی را پیدا کند که کارایی سیستم ها را با استفاده از اسکریپت های پایتون کاهش می دهد.
هک با پایتون به چه منظوری مطرح است؟
حال هک با پایتون به چه منظوری مورد استفاده قرار میگیرد؟ پایتون یک زبان برنامه نویسی همه منظوره و سطح بالا است که به طور گسترده مورد استفاده قرار می گیرد. پایتون یک زبان بسیار ساده و در عین حال زبان اسکریپت نویسی قدرتمند است، منبع باز و شی گرا است و کتابخانه های خوبی دارد که هم برای هک کردن و هم برای نوشتن برنامه های معمولی بسیار مفید است که به غیر از تدوین برنامه های هک می توان از آن استفاده کرد. در آینده و عصر حاضر، پایتون بسیار محبوب است و یادگیری آن آسان است، یادگیری هک با پایتون سرگرم کننده خواهد بود و از این طریق برنامه نویسی پایتون را به بهترین شکل یاد خواهید گرفت. تقاضای کار زیادی برای توسعه دهندگان پایتون در بازار کار وجود دارد و این سادگی و جذابیت در کنار کاربرد گسترده این زبان برنامه نویسی، باعث شده است آموزش پایتون برای کودکان و نوجوانان بیش از پیش مطرح شود و در سراسر جهان در اولویت قرار گیرد تا نسل آینده نسلی آگاه از برنامه نویسی و دنیای مدرن تکنولوژی باشد.
انواع هک و هک با پایتون
وقتی اسم هک به میان می آید معمولا جنبه منفی هک به ذهن مخاطبان خطور میکند؛ اما تمام هکر ها یکسان نیستند، بسیاری از هکر ها توانایی انجام کار های مخرب را دارند اما از این توانایی در راستای کمک به امنیت شبکه استفاده میکنند. بنابرین بر اساس نوع کار آنها را به چند قسمت تقسیم می کنند.
1. هک کلاه سیاه
در اینجا، سازمان به کاربر اجازه آزمایش بر روی سایت خود را نمی دهد. آنها به طور غیراخلاقی وارد وب سایت می شوند و داده ها را از پنل مدیریت سرقت می کنند یا داده ها را دستکاری می کنند. آنها فقط بر روی خود و مزایایی که از داده های شخصی برای منافع مالی شخصی به دست خواهند آورد تمرکز می کنند. این هکرها می توانند با تغییر عملکردها که منجر به از دست دادن داده های شرکت به میزان بسیار بالاتری می شود، آسیب بزرگی به شرکت وارد کنند. این نوع هک که به عنوان هک کلاه سیاه شناخته می شود و دارای پیگرد قانونی است که به هیچ عنوان پیشنهاد نمی شود.
2. هک کلاه سفید
در این نوع هک، هکر با اجازه مسئول مرتبط به دنبال اشکالات می گردد و آن را به سازمان گزارش می دهد. هکرهای کلاه سفید عموماً تمام اطلاعات مورد نیاز در مورد برنامه یا شبکه را برای آزمایش از خود سازمان دریافت می کنند. آنها از مهارت های خود برای آزمایش سایت یا نرم افزار معرفی شده استفاده می کنند قبل از اینکه وب سایت فعال شود یا توسط هکرهای مخرب مورد حمله قرار گیرد. هک و هکر کلاه سفید تقریبا در مقابل کلاه سیاه قرار داشته و تلاش آن برای جلوگیری از نفوذ به سایت و همچنین بالا بردن امنیت نرم افزار یا وب سایت است.
حال میتوانید بهتر منظور این مقاله و آموزش ها در هک با پایتون را متوجه شوید که در اصل میتوان گفت امنیت شبکه با پایتون ارتقا یافته و در برابر هکر ها استحکام بیشتری خواهد داشت و آموزش هک با پایتون در راستای امنیت شبکه داده می شود.
3. هک کلاه خاکستری :
هکر های کلاه خاکستری گاهی اوقات به داده ها دسترسی پیدا می کنند و قانون را نقض می کنند. اما هرگز نیت مشابهی با هکرهای کلاه سیاه ندارند، آنها اغلب برای منافع عمومی عمل می کنند. تفاوت اصلی این است که آنها از آسیب پذیری به صورت عمومی سوء استفاده می کنند در حالی که هکرهای کلاه سفید این کار را به صورت خصوصی برای شرکت انجام می دهند. در واقع ممکن است نفع شخصی برای هکر های کلاه خاکستری مطرح نباشد.
حال شاید این سوال در ذهنتان ایجاد شده باشد که هک با پایتون ما را در کدام یک از این گروه ها قرار می دهد، جواب سوال ساده است، شما خودتان به عنوان یکی از افراد مرتبط در این زمینه تعیین می کنید که کدام کلاه را بر سر بگذارید، انتخاب با شماست که در کدام زمینه می خواهید کار کنید.
هک اخلاقی
هک اخلاقی چیست؟ هک با پایتون اخلاقی است؟ برای شکستن رمزهای عبور یا سرقت اطلاعات؟ نه، خیلی بیشتر از این است. هک اخلاقی برای اسکن آسیب پذیری ها و یافتن تهدیدهای بالقوه در رایانه یا شبکه ها است. یک هکر اخلاقی نقاط ضعف یا حفره های موجود در یک کامپیوتر، برنامه های کاربردی وب یا شبکه را پیدا کرده و آنها را به سازمان گزارش می دهد. بنابراین، بیایید گام به گام درباره هک اخلاقی (کلاه سفید) بیشتر بررسی کنیم.
اصطلاح هک قدمت زیادی دارد. به طور دقیق، همه چیز از MIT شروع شد، جایی که هر دو اصطلاح “هک” و “هکر” برای اولین بار ابداع شدند. اکنون تقریباً 50 سال از آن زمان می گذرد و هک کردن به یک رشته در عصر کنونی تبدیل شده است. با افزایش آگاهی در مورد حفاظت از داده ها و حفظ حریم خصوصی داده ها، امروزه هک یک فعالیت غیرقانونی تلقی می شود. در صورت دستگیری، این احتمال وجود دارد که بسته به میزان آسیب وارده، مدتی تحت پیگرد قانونی قرار بگیرید.
با این وجود، برای محافظت از خود در برابر انواع هکرها، به کارگیری هکرهای اخلاقی به یک روش رایج در بین سازمان ها تبدیل شده است. هکرهای اخلاقی مسئولیت دارند نقص های امنیتی یک سازمان خاص را قبل از اینکه هکرهای کلاه سیاه آنها را پیدا کنند، یافته و برطرف کنند.
جایگاه هک با پایتون در آکادمی یاسان
در آکادمی یاسان در راستای آموزش برنامه نویسی به کودکان و نوجوانان زبان های برنامه نویسی متنوعی به آنها آموزش داده میشود که با توجه به گستردگی و مزایای زبان برنامه نویسی پایتون، آموزش مقدماتی پایتون نیز در این کلاس ها جاگرفت. دوره پایتون آکادمی یاسان در وهله اول در راستای آشنایی کودکان با پایتون صورت میگیرد و در سطوح پیشرفته تر آموزش کاربرد های تخصصی پایتون و استفاده از پایتون در امنیت شبکه و هک اخلاقی مدنظر است.